Cost Evaluation of Agent of Record Services




When examining the expense of agent solutions, organizations will discover a range of pricing models according to the company and the range of services offered. Usually, the minimal registered agent price can fluctuate from $50 to $300 dollars each year. This fee usually covers the basic responsibilities of handling legal documents and official mail on behalf of the firm. However, organizations must assess what is covered in these initial costs, as certain providers may offer additional services such as reminders for compliance, management of documents, and web access to critical documents.




For startups seeking cost-effective registered agent services, a few companies offer basic packages at lower rates, which may be suitable for startups and small firms. Compliance and Legal Responsibilities




A registered agent holds a crucial role in ensuring that a entity meets its compliance requirements. They act as the primary point of communication for handling essential judicial documents, such as lawsuits, summons, and various federal correspondence. This duty requires the registered agent to preserve a reliable presence and be on call during regular hours to confirm swift delivery of these critical documents. By doing so, they provide peace of mind that critical updates are not missed, which is crucial for any business's functional stability.




Additionally, a dependable state agent is essential for preserving good standing with the state. Companies are required to submit various filings on an annual basis, and inability to do so can result in penalties or even the termination of the entity. A qualified state agent provides regulatory notifications and help with yearly compliance filings, guaranteeing that due dates are met and stopping unnecessary issues. This forward-thinking approach helps entities address the complexities of compliance requirements and sustain their corporate status.




Lastly, the designated agent is responsible for ensuring the security of private information. By serving as an middleman for legal notifications and other legal documents, the designated agent helps protect the business's confidentiality. This confidentiality is particularly important for small businesses that may not want their home addresses publicly available. Consequently, utilizing a trustworthy registered agent not only aids regulatory adherence but also improves the overall protection and professionalism of a company.

Common Questions About Registered Agents




A common frequently asked question is what a registered agent actually does. A registered agent serves as an official contact person for your business, handling crucial legal documents and government notices for your entity. This includes tax-related documents, legal summons, and compliance notifications. In essence, they ensure that you are informed about all legal matters that might impact your business, offering a vital service that helps maintain your compliance with state requirements.




Additionally, frequently asked questions revolve around who can serve as a registered agent. Typically, the registered agent must be a legal resident of the state where your business is formed or a business that is authorized to operate in that state. This can include individuals or professional registered agents. Many businesses opt for professional registered agent services to guarantee reliability and protect privacy, as these agents offer a secure address to receive official documents, protecting the owner's personal address from public records.
